Feeling this is what I think to be his best drumming. The grooves he plays for the first half of the song are not straight backbeats, so when he comes out of the bridge with a straight punk beat it hits like a ton of bricks. Not to mention that quarter note triplet leading into the final chorus and those crazy fast fills. Def my favorite blink song
